description 碩士 === 國立成功大學 === 海洋科技與事務研究所 === 99 === The purpose of this paper is to establish the coastal buffer zone around Taiwan coast.We take some representative coasts as the bench mark of the study area, including harbor areas, river estuaries and offshore islands. Based on the concept of hydrodynamics and coastal procseses, the appropriate range of the coastal buffer zone will be discussed and determined. The seaward boundary of the coast buffer zone is assessed using the SBEACH software with 50-year return period typhoon wave conditions as the input data. The landward boundary of coastal buffer zone is estimated by wave run-up empirical formulas. According to the results of the numerical simulations and calculations, some instructive suggestions are proposed for planning the coastal buffer zone at Taiwanese Coasts. Based on the results of SBEACH software and wave run-up empirical formulas, the selected section of coast provides the width of the buffer zone. The highlights of the thesis include the following parts. (1) Large ports, such as Taichung harbor, its enormous scale obstructs to make a plan on the seaward boundary. Therefore, the harbor is a board line which extends to this both sides of costal buffer zone. (2)When we plan the land boundaries , this location consists of estuaries which results in discontinuous boundries. In this case, the harbor can make a connection with the coastal buffer zone which makes the area is easily organized and provided the consistency. (3) Offshore islands face different directions of the sea which cause the harbor to receive the diversity of typhoone waves. Because of the small islands, the procedures for deciding the shoreline boundary is complicated. For this case, we recommend to take the maximum value of the simulating results and make a unified plan in the island, based on the value less than the maximum typhoon waves. (4) In the same section of coast, such as the existence of flat and deep topographies at the junction of sea boundries that are hard to draw the boarder. It is desirable to perform the average connection or use the maximum value for the planning used directly to plan the maximum value.
